Whether you just graduated, suffered a career-ending injury, got cut, or are simply saying goodbye to the sport you love, this episode from the heart of Former Division I Volleyball Player and PAC-12 Champion, Victoria Garrick, has 6 meaningful pieces of advice that will help guide you towards whatever may be next in life.
